Travel Like a Pro: Essential Tips & Tricks

Transport on a Dime: Opt for colectivos (shared vans) or second-class buses for budget-friendly yet authentic intercity travel.

Gastronomic Adventures: Dive into the world of street food. From tacos to churros, taste authentic Mexico without denting your wallet.

Lingo Basics: Master a few Spanish phrases. From haggling to asking directions, it’ll make your journey smoother.

Stay Alert, Stay Safe: Stick to main roads during night-time, be wary of unsolicited guides, and always keep an eye on your belongings.

Cultural Sensitivity: Always dress modestly when visiting religious sites and ask before capturing moments on your camera.

Hidden Gems: Off-the-Radar Wonders

Las Pozas: Nestled in San Luis Potosí, discover a surreal sculpture garden set amidst a tropical jungle.

Puebla’s Biblioteca Palafoxiana: A bibliophile’s dream, this is the oldest public library in the Americas.

Mazunte: Move away from the crowds to this tranquil beach town known for its sea turtles and laid-back ambiance.
